diff options
author | Glenn Kasten <gkasten@google.com> | 2015-03-09 12:00:30 -0700 |
---|---|---|
committer | Glenn Kasten <gkasten@google.com> | 2015-03-09 14:17:25 -0700 |
commit | b46f394a85d704dd05287cf9bb77cf86e3c02a38 (patch) | |
tree | b6f8c4c2d413ca71ef3b2ca0c5a32c97d7959979 /media | |
parent | 54a8a456c2b4b382b3ffe3d99e40703df79c0717 (diff) | |
download | frameworks_av-b46f394a85d704dd05287cf9bb77cf86e3c02a38.zip frameworks_av-b46f394a85d704dd05287cf9bb77cf86e3c02a38.tar.gz frameworks_av-b46f394a85d704dd05287cf9bb77cf86e3c02a38.tar.bz2 |
AudioTrack::obtainBuffer() now returns number of non-contiguous frames
Change-Id: I1f61d7e3d057c3254babe456b4aa0f6a1809da55
Diffstat (limited to 'media')
-rw-r--r-- | media/libmedia/AudioTrack.cpp |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/media/libmedia/AudioTrack.cpp b/media/libmedia/AudioTrack.cpp index 0713c66..720db17 100644 --- a/media/libmedia/AudioTrack.cpp +++ b/media/libmedia/AudioTrack.cpp @@ -1236,7 +1236,7 @@ release: return status; } -status_t AudioTrack::obtainBuffer(Buffer* audioBuffer, int32_t waitCount) +status_t AudioTrack::obtainBuffer(Buffer* audioBuffer, int32_t waitCount, size_t *nonContig) { if (audioBuffer == NULL) { return BAD_VALUE; @@ -1263,7 +1263,7 @@ status_t AudioTrack::obtainBuffer(Buffer* audioBuffer, int32_t waitCount) ALOGE("%s invalid waitCount %d", __func__, waitCount); requested = NULL; } - return obtainBuffer(audioBuffer, requested); + return obtainBuffer(audioBuffer, requested, NULL /*elapsed*/, nonContig); } status_t AudioTrack::obtainBuffer(Buffer* audioBuffer, const struct timespec *requested, |